The Films That Defined a Career
Milstead's collaboration with John Waters resulted in some of the most iconic films in underground cinema history. Movies like "Pink Flamingos," "Female Trouble," and "Polyester" pushed the boundaries of what was considered acceptable in mainstream media. These films weren't just entertainment; they were statements, challenges to the status quo, and celebrations of individuality.

- "Pink Flamingos" (1972) - This film put Divine on the map and is often cited as one of the most outrageous movies ever made.
- "Female Trouble" (1974) - A dark comedy that explored themes of identity and societal expectations.
- "Polyester" (1981) - Known for its "Odorama" gimmick, this film continued to push the boundaries of what cinema could be.

Dealing with Censorship
The films that Milstead and Waters created were often met with resistance from censors and conservative groups. But instead of backing down, they used these challenges to fuel their creativity. They turned controversy into a marketing tool, making their films even more appealing to audiences who were hungry for something different.
